Transfer your pet to a new owner
When your pet moves to a new forever home, your Driyu pet profile and smart tag can go with them. Ownership Transfer hands the pet profile to the new owner inside Driyu, so the tag keeps working and nothing has to be set up from scratch.
What matters most
The profile moves
The pet profile and history move to the new owner inside Driyu.
The tag stays with the pet
The smart tag already on your pet keeps working and stays connected to the same profile through the transfer.
Private things stay private
Personal emergency contacts, expenses, and reminders stay with you, the previous owner.

How it works
Ownership Transfer is a short, guided flow inside Driyu. Here is what happens, step by step.
- Open Driyu and go to the pet you want to transfer.
- Choose Transfer ownership and enter the new owner email address.
- Driyu creates a secure transfer invitation for that email.
- The new owner opens the invitation and signs in, or creates a free Driyu account.
- The new owner confirms their email.
- The new owner accepts the transfer.
- The pet Driyu profile moves to the new owner, and the smart tag stays connected to the same pet.
Who it is for
Ownership Transfer is for a permanent change of owner: a foster dog going to a forever home, an adoption, a rehoming, a family member taking over permanent care, or when you can no longer keep your pet. For foster families, transferring keeps the pet setup ready for the forever home, so the smart tag and profile move with the pet and the new owner starts with everything already collected.
What moves, and what stays with you
Ownership Transfer gives the new owner the pet Driyu profile, photos, medical records, documents, and health history, plus the smart tag connection, so they start with everything already collected. Owner-specific details stay with you, the previous owner, and stay private: your personal emergency contacts, expenses, and reminders do not move to the new owner. Some Pro features may need a Driyu Pro plan to view or manage. Ownership Transfer covers your Driyu setup and is separate from legal adoption, shelter, or rescue paperwork.
Common questions
Should I transfer my pet or share access?
Transfer when the pet is permanently moving to a new owner. If the pet is still yours and someone needs to help, use Family Sync (Pro Beta) instead.
Can I use this for a pet sitter?
For a pet sitter, the pet is still yours, so the better fit is Family Sync. Add them while you need help and remove their access afterward. Ownership Transfer is meant for a permanent change of owner.
Can someone help manage my pet without becoming the owner?
Yes. Add them in Family Sync as a Guardian so they can help manage the pet. You stay the owner.
Can someone only view my pet information?
Yes. Add them in Family Sync as a Viewer for view-only access. And when someone scans the tag or opens your Lost Mode page, they see a view-only recovery profile they cannot edit. You choose which contact details appear, and your home address and full medical records are never shown.
What is the difference between Family Sync and Ownership Transfer?
Family Sync (Pro Beta) shares access while the pet stays yours, and you can remove it at any time. Ownership Transfer permanently makes someone else the owner.
If I transfer ownership, can I still edit the pet profile?
Once the new owner accepts, they take over managing the pet inside Driyu, so editing moves to them. Until they accept, the pet is still yours.
Does the smart tag stay with the pet?
Yes. The smart tag already on your pet keeps working and stays connected to the same pet profile through the transfer. The new owner does not have to order a replacement tag or wait for a new one to arrive.
Can I transfer to someone who does not have a Driyu account yet?
Yes. The new owner does not need a Driyu account first. When they accept, they sign in or create a free Driyu account and confirm their email.
What information transfers?
The pet profile, photos, medical records, documents, and health history move with the pet. Some Pro features may need a Driyu Pro plan to view or manage.
What information stays private?
Owner-specific details stay with you, the previous owner. Your personal emergency contacts, expenses, and reminders do not move to the new owner.
Is this legal adoption paperwork?
Ownership Transfer moves the Driyu profile, the tag connection, and app ownership inside Driyu. It is separate from legal adoption, shelter, or rescue paperwork, which you handle the usual way.
Is there a fee to transfer?
There is no fee to transfer a pet inside Driyu. Some Pro features may need a Driyu Pro plan to view or manage.
